Halal is an Arabic word meaning ‘lawful’ or ‘permitted’. In Malaysia, there is a general misconception that anything that is pork-free is halal. In fact, there is more to the definition of halal as it encompasses the whole manufacturing process of the product, including:
- raw materials used
- how animals are bred or slaughtered
- the way ingedients are packed

Products containing gelatine have always been avoided by Muslims for fear that they may or may not come from halal sources.
